Rough week at our house...... I has been a rough week in our household! Max went to the vet on Thursday and he has an anal glad abscess. He is on lots of medicine, but is doing fine. Tatiana went and got her Rabies shot on Saturday. She had benedryl before and had no reaction from the shot. She is up to 2.6 pounds at 6 months of age! Yea!!! :) Yesterday, we had another scare with Tatiana. We were at a family gathering. We were eating on the deck and there are lots of little kids sitting on the floor with their plates. While I was helping others get their plates, she grabbed a bite of hot dog.....it got caught in her throat!:eek: My DH saw it and grabbed her and was yelling my name. As I turned to see what he wanted, out came the hot dog. My husband had squeezed her tummy to get the hot dog out! I guess like the Hymlick (sp) the force brought the hot dog up! Thank the Lord! Please everyone, with summer upon us and lots of picnics and hot dogs, please watch your yorkies for the dangers around them! They are all so quick and don't know how dangerous that one little bite can be! |
